Allis Chalmers HD21
The Allis Chalmers HD21 is a powerful tractor built for heavy-duty work. It has a strong diesel engine made by Allis-Chalmers with 6 cylinders. This engine can produce 225 horsepower, which is a lot of power for big jobs. The engine is cooled by liquid and has a supercharger to make it even stronger. This tractor is big and heavy, weighing 45,500 pounds. It's 198 inches long and 99 inches tall. The HD21 has a torque converter transmission with 2 forward gears and 1 reverse gear. This helps it move easily in different conditions. The tractor starts with an electric starter that uses 24 volts. It also has an oil bath air cleaner to keep the engine clean and running well. Allis Chalmers was known for making tough farm equipment. The HD21 shows this with its strong build and features. It can hold 80 quarts of coolant, which helps keep the engine cool during long work days. This tractor is made for farmers who need a reliable machine for big tasks on their farms.

Full specifications
Every recorded spec
General
| Manufacturer | Allis Chalmers |
|---|---|
| Model | HD21 |
| Category | Agricultural tractor |
| Operating weight | 45,500lb |
Engine
| Make | Allis-Chalmers |
|---|---|
| Power | 225hp |
| Cylinders | 6 |
| Displacement | 844ci |
| Bore | 5.25in |
| Stroke | 6.5in |
Transmission
| Type | Torque Converter |
|---|---|
| Forward gears | 2 |
| Reverse gears | 1 |
Dimensions
| Length | 198in |
|---|---|
| Height | 99in |
| Operating weight | 45,500lb |
Capacities
| Cooling system | 20gal |
